Subject: DR drill Tuesday — kiosk watchdog

Welcome aboard. Tuesday we run the quarterly disaster-recovery drill on the Pellbright kiosk fleet. We'll kill the Ostrawick watchdog on ten units and confirm auto-restart within 90 seconds. Your job: log restart times and flag any kiosk stuck on the boot splash. Stuck units need a manual unseal of the local config vault from the service menu. The vault takes the recovery passphrase written below.

unlock words, yawig-kagef: gordor-holvan-ulaael-pramir-ulaiel-tamdor

# Break-Glass Access — MarkWeave Rendering Pipeline

This page covers emergency access to the MarkWeave markdown pipeline when normal credentials are unavailable. Break-glass should only be used if the renderer is down and both on-call leads are unreachable. Reviewers approving emergency patches must log the incident number in the Tally board within one hour. Access grants expire after 45 minutes and all actions are recorded. After confirming the outage, unseal the emergency store using the recovery passphrase below.

unlock words, hahip-yagef: zorok-novmir-zorix-silax

Handover: Tracelink spans now propagate through all nine Quartzbeam services. Fixed the dropped context in the Fennel gateway; redeploy before Friday's cut. Dashboards under the Rivermouth tenant. Marta owns sampling config; don't touch it mid-release. If the trace vault locks during rollout, you'll need the recovery passphrase, which is:

vault phrase of bagaf-kajeg = jorath-feniel-briir-siliel-ralix

Sales leads, please review ahead of Thursday's session. The proposed venture with Korvane Systems would combine our Meridian Analytics platform with their distribution network across the Ostbridge region. Due diligence by Fenwick Hale's team flagged no material concerns, though margin assumptions in year one remain conservative. Revenue sharing terms are still under negotiation and should not be discussed with prospects. The strategic rationale is summarised in the confidential note below.

board note of bagag-fajog: The pricing group signed off on a budget of $34.6 million for Project Novwyn. The renewal with Aldathek Partners closes at $44.0 million a year, 34 percent below the last contract.